The ownership of Godwin has also changed many times over the years. In 1970, Red split Godwin Hardware & Plumbing into two separate companies. He and his wife kept 100% of the hardware business and sold 50% of the plumbing company to five key employees, Don Vredevoogd, Mel Visser, Ed VanderWal, Herm Dykstra, and his son, Ron Brummel. After a number of years, Ron decided to venture out on his own and left Godwin Plumbing. Don handled the service department, Mel took care of the commercial accounts, Ed was the resident bookkeeper, and Herm used his sales skill he learned as a cookie salesman to handle the retail sales and buying. In 1981 Red sold his share of Godwin Plumbing to the four other owners but continued with the ownership of the hardware and the property as well as other interests.
Don was the first to retire in 1983 and sold his shares back to the company and in 1987 the others retired also. In June of 1987, Walt, Bob and Pete signed the papers for complete ownership of Godwin Plumbing. In February of 1987, "Red" died of a heart attack while golfing in Florida and in July 1988 they bought the hardware from Louise and started the other branches after that. Over the years there have been many changes in management and leadership positions. The companies have grown from 3 people in 1955 to 65 people including 35 plumbers on the road in 1980 and then to the present size of a total of 185 employees, which includes about 90 plumbers on the road. Bob decided it was time to start scaling back on work a little and as of January 1, 2000, Bob sold a portion of his ownership in Godwin Plumbing to Bruce DeBoer, Rick Lameyer, and Tim Buist. These three newest owners have proven themselves over the years as leaders and work extremely hard every day for the benefit and advancement of the company. Rick joined his father in working as a plumber for Godwin in 1977 and was the main residential "rough-in man" for many years. He moved into the office a couple of years ago and took over the scheduling duties as well as many other chores. Bruce started at Godwin in 1978 and worked most of the time as a job foreman for commercial plumbing jobs. He moved into the office in 1991 as a commercial Project Manager and quotes and handles many important accounts including Dan Vos Construction. Tim Buist joined Godwin Plumbing right out of high school in 1980 and worked in the warehouse and then for Godwin Fire Protection while that branch was operating. Shortly after the fire protection business closed he moved into the office and took over the Service Manager duties from Don and since has assumed the job of General Manager, which includes a variety of responsibilities.
